GLP-1 Drugs Like Ozempic Are Unlikely To Cause Hypoglycemia On Their Own In the case of drugs like Ozempic, which is a GLP-1 agonist, they are unlikely to cause hypoglycemia when used as monotherapy (i.e., without other diabetes drugs) simply due to the way they work
